Just to warn you when we went home in 2010 we had a really bad experience with Crown the salesman were lovely the crew on the ground were understaffed, untrained and did not complete packing in time so loads of our stuff was literally thrown in the van, when we got the other end crown had contracted out the job, they had renumbered every item on the packing list so out list did not correspond, (we had packed unbreakables as agreed, they repacked these pack at the depot mixing items up and to this day I still can not tell you if we have lost anything.
When the guys unloaded we were several big items missing including dinning table top, beds etc after several conversations with the Crown HQ (as they did not believe us) they found most of our stuff still sitting in NZ
we have now moved a few times and to be quite frank the sales people can say anything but what happens on the day is so different and its the luck of the draw what crew you get and the standard of service you recieve.

We returned to UK March 2011, we used Conroys for moving.
Sadly I can not recommend them,they under estimated the amount of furniture we had, so we had to pay more.
They lost our washing machine and wardrobe. The boxes which we packed ourselves had been repacked very badly. For instance we had kitchen items mixed in with tools. We had broken items as well. Luckily we had taken out insurance and were able to claim for the missing and broken items.

OK, I now have a series of quotes from Conroys, Pickfords and Crown to do a door-to-door service from Auckland to Brighton.
We are insuring our goods to a value of $6,000.
Conroys:
Option A) 1 cubic metre of cartons + Insurance =$920
Option B) 1.5 cubic metres of cartons + Insurance =$959
Option C) 2 cubic metres of cartons + Insurance =$1059
Option D) 3 cubic metres of cartons + Insturance = $1275
Pickfords:
Option A) 1 cubic metre of cartons + Insurance =$1090
Option B) 1.5 cubic metres of cartons + Insurance =$1324
Option C) 2 cubic metres of cartons + Insurance =$1558
Option D) 3 cubic metres of cartons + Insturance = $2041
Crown:
Option A) 1 cubic metre of cartons WITHOUT Insurance =$1200
Option B) 1.5 cubic metres of cartons WITHOUT Insurance = $1350
Option C) 2 cubic metres of cartons WITHOUT Insurance = $1500
Option D) 3 cubic metres of cartons WITHOUT Insurance = $1750
Crown insurance is an additional $690 for each quote.
So based on the above, we have ruled our Crown but are torn between Pickfords and Conroys.
We used Pickfords to ship here and they did an excellent job. Conroys are the cheapest, and also I have read some fairly damning reviews of Conroys.
